Then it appears that devfs is broken, or something else.
devfsd-1.3.25-23mdk
Before installing lircd:
[EMAIL PROTECTED] dev]# ls -l /dev/li*
srw-rw-rw- 1 root root 0 Mar 15 10:35 /dev/lircd=
/dev/lirc:
total 0
[EMAIL PROTECTED] dev]# urpmi lirc
installing
/var/cooker/ftp.orst.edu/.1/mandrake-devel/cooker/cooker/Mandrake/RPMS/lirc-0.6.6-1mdk.i586.rpm
Edited /etc/sysconfig/lirc to use pinsys, serial and COM2:
# Customized setings for lirc daemon
# The hardware driver to use, run lircd --driver=? for a list
DRIVER=pinsys
# Hardware driver module to load
HWMOD=serial
# The device node that communicates with the IR device.
# with devfs enabled
DEVICE=/dev/lirc/1
#DEVICE=/dev/lirc/serial
# without devfs
#DEVICE=/dev/lirc
# Serial port for the receiver (for serial driver)
# COM1 (/dev/ttyS0)
#COM_PORT=/dev/ttyS0
#DRIVER_OPTS="irq=4 io=0x3f8"
# COM2 (/dev/ttyS1)
COM_PORT=/dev/ttyS1
DRIVER_OPTS="irq=3 io=0x2f8"
<save>
# /etc/rc.d/init.d/lircd start
Starting Linux Infrared Remote Control daemon: [ OK ]
/var/log/messages:
Mar 17 09:58:09 backend2 lircd 0.6.6[7173]: lircd(any) ready
Mar 17 09:58:09 backend2 lircd: lircd startup succeeded
[EMAIL PROTECTED] dev]# ls -l li*
srw-rw-rw- 1 root root 0 Mar 15 10:35 lircd=
lirc:
total 0
[EMAIL PROTECTED] dev]#
[Note that there is no symlink in /dev/lirc/1 back to ttyS1]
[EMAIL PROTECTED] mythtv]$ irw
[Immediately returns]
Mar 17 10:00:10 backend2 lircd 0.6.6[7173]: accepted new client on /tmp/.lircd
Mar 17 10:00:10 backend2 lircd 0.6.6[7173]: readlink() failed for "/dev/lirc/1"
Mar 17 10:00:10 backend2 lircd 0.6.6[7173]: No such file or directory
Mar 17 10:00:10 backend2 lircd 0.6.6[7173]: could not create lock files
Mar 17 10:00:10 backend2 lircd 0.6.6[7173]: caught signal
[EMAIL PROTECTED] dev]# /etc/rc.d/init.d/lircd status
lircd dead but subsys locked
[EMAIL PROTECTED] dev]# cd lirc
[EMAIL PROTECTED] lirc]# ls -l
total 0
[EMAIL PROTECTED] lirc]# ln -sf ../ttyS1 1
[EMAIL PROTECTED] lirc]# ls -l
total 0
lr-xr-xr-x 1 root root 8 Mar 17 10:02 1 -> ../ttyS1
[EMAIL PROTECTED] lirc]# /etc/rc.d/init.d/lircd restart
Stopping Linux Infrared Remote Control daemon: [FAILED]
Starting Linux Infrared Remote Control daemon: [ OK ]
[EMAIL PROTECTED] lirc]#
[EMAIL PROTECTED] mythtv]$ irw
000000000000001a 00 middle PinnacleSysPCTVRemote
000000000000003f 00 Chan+Play PinnacleSysPCTVRemote
000000000000002f 00 Power PinnacleSysPCTVRemote
Mar 17 10:08:49 backend2 lircd 0.6.6[7366]: accepted new client on /tmp/.lircd
Mar 17 10:08:49 backend2 lircd 0.6.6[7366]: could not create lock file
"/var/lock/LCK..1"
Mar 17 10:08:49 backend2 lircd 0.6.6[7366]: File exists
Mar 17 10:08:49 backend2 lircd 0.6.6[7366]: tts/1 is locked by PID 7366
[ie, it works.]
So, I maintain that something is not correct; lirc did not work until I manually
created the
symlink in /dev/lirc/ from /dev/ttyS1 to /dev/lirc/1

I have a pinnacle systems "dumb" IR receiver which connects to the COM1 / COM2 serial
port.
The example /etc/sysconfig/lircd file gives the user no indication that they need to
create a
symlink between the actual tty device and the /dev/lirc entry.
Here's a working example:
# Customized setings for lirc daemon
# The hardware driver to use, run lircd --driver=? for a list
DRIVER=pinsys
# Hardware driver module to load
HWMOD=serial
# The device node that communicates with the IR device.
# with devfs enabled
DEVICE=/dev/lirc/1
<snip>
[EMAIL PROTECTED] dev]# ls -l /dev/lirc/1
lr-xr-xr-x 1 root root 10 Mar 15 21:48 /dev/lirc/1 -> /dev/ttyS1
It took me about 2 hours to figure this out. I recommend that the lircd file be a
little more
verbose with examples.
Here is an updated /etc/sysconfig/lircd file that I think explains things better.
(Note that the symlink is created correctly when manually installing lirc from a
tarball because
the lirc configure program does this as a part of the installation process)
[EMAIL PROTECTED] sysconfig]# cat lircd
# Customized setings for lirc daemon
# The hardware driver to use, run lircd --driver=? for a list
DRIVER=UNCONFIGURED
# Hardware driver module to load
# Choices are:
# serial
# lirc_serial (for home-brew serial port IR receivers)
# lirc_parallel
# etc. See /lib/modules/{kern-version}/kernel/3rdparty/lirc for a
# list of modules.
HWMOD=UNCONFIGURED
# The device node that communicates with the IR device.
# If you are using a serial device, create a symlink between the actual
# hardware device and the /dev/lirc/ entry
# Example for receiver connected to COM1
# <as root># cd /dev
# <as root># ln -sf ttyS0 lirc/0
# or <as root># ln -sf ttyS0 lirc/serial
# If you are using devfs, use one of the following and create the symlink
# as shown above
# DEVICE=/dev/lirc/0
# DEVICE=/dev/lirc/serial
# Without devfs:
# If you are using a serial device, create a symlink between the actual
# hardware device and the /dev/lirc entry
# Example for receiver connected to COM1
# <as root># cd /dev
# <as root># ln -sf ttyS0 lirc
# DEVICE=/dev/lirc
# Serial port for the receiver (for serial driver)
# COM1 (/dev/ttyS0)
#COM_PORT=/dev/ttyS0
#DRIVER_OPTS="irq=4 io=0x3f8"
# COM2 (/dev/ttyS1)
#COM_PORT=/dev/ttyS1
#DRIVER_OPTS="irq=3 io=0x2f8"
# COM3 (/dev/ttyS2)
#COM_PORT=/dev/ttyS2
#DRIVER_OPTS="irq=4 io=0x3e8
# COM4 (/dev/ttyS3)
#COM_PORT=/dev/ttyS3
#DRIVER_OPTS="irq=3 io=0x2e8"
